After twenty years away from the firm, raising three children, Joyce seamlessly returned to her passion of architecture, quickly flattening the learning curve and letting her design and presentation skills shine again. Her key to project management is knowing how to communicate the client’s vision to her team effectively.

Joyce has a talent for bringing together the right people and providing her team with what they need to create and execute the design elements that can fulfill clients’ goals and budget requirements. As a result, she’s responsible for multiple projects that have received design and livability awards, mainly in multifamily and senior housing communities featuring a variety of amenity buildings and areas. But her gifts don’t stop there. She’s an accomplished artist and watercolorist with work featured in numerous publications, and she still owns a studio specializing in animal and human portraits as well as architectural renderings.

Joyce earned a Bachelor of Science in Architecture from the Georgia Institute of Technology. She also holds membership in the American Institute of Architects, American Institute of Architectural illustrations and the Georgia Watercolor Society. As an active participant in NBA’s lunch and learns and roundtable discussions, she focuses on advancements in the evolving nature of multifamily housing.
